History Important Questions Chapter 8 An Ideal Ruler Class 7 Maharashtra Board

Imp Questions For All Chapters – History Class 7

Short Questions


1. Who was Afzal Khan?

  • Afzal Khan was a general of Adilshahi Sultanate.

2. Where did Shivaji Maharaj meet Afzal Khan?

  • At Pratapgad Fort.

3. Who helped Shivaji Maharaj escape from Agra?

  • Hiroji Farzand and Madari Meheter.

4. What warning did Shivaji Maharaj give to his soldiers?

  • Not to harm farmers or loot their food.

5. What was Shivaji Maharaj’s religious policy?

  • He followed religious tolerance.

6. Which poet wrote about Shivaji Maharaj in Tamil?

  • Subramania Bharati.

7. What was Shivaji Maharaj’s rule about captured soldiers?

  • They were treated fairly and with respect.

8. Who was Daulat Khan?

  • He was an officer in Shivaji Maharaj’s navy.

9. What was Shivaji Maharaj’s policy for the army?

  • Soldiers were paid in cash and not allowed to loot people.

10. Which fort was built to strengthen the navy?

  • Sindhudurg Fort.

11. Who wrote a Powada on Shivaji Maharaj?

  • Mahatma Jotirao Phule.

12. Where did Shivaji Maharaj warn Deshmukhs to protect farmers?

  • In Rohida Valley.

13. Who established an independent kingdom in Bundelkhand?

  • Chhatrasal.

14. What did Shivaji Maharaj do for dead soldiers’ families?

  • They were supported by the state.

15. What was the biggest challenge Shivaji Maharaj faced?

  • Escaping from Agra after being captured by Aurangzeb.

Long Questions


1. Why did Shivaji Maharaj kill Afzal Khan?

  • Afzal Khan planned to kill Shivaji Maharaj using a trick, but Shivaji Maharaj defended himself with a tiger claw and won.

2. How did Shivaji Maharaj escape from Agra?

  • He pretended to be sick, hid in fruit baskets, and escaped with Hiroji Farzand and Madari Meheter’s help.

3. How did Shivaji Maharaj treat captured enemy soldiers?

  • He treated them fairly, did not harm them, and even gave them jobs in his army or administration.

4. What was Shivaji Maharaj’s rule for his soldiers?

  • Soldiers were not allowed to loot farmers, harm women, or destroy temples, and they were paid salaries in cash.

5. Why is Shivaji Maharaj’s religious policy admired?

  • He respected all religions, protected mosques, and appointed Muslim officers in his army, showing religious tolerance.

6. How did Shivaji Maharaj strengthen the navy?

  • He built Sindhudurg Fort, created strong warships, and protected Maharashtra’s coastline from Siddis, Portuguese, and British.

7. Why did Shivaji Maharaj warn the Deshmukh of Rohida Valley?

  • He warned Deshmukhs to move farmers to safe places during attacks, ensuring their safety from enemy invasions.

8. Why is Shivaji Maharaj remembered as a great king?

  • He was a brave and just ruler who protected Swaraj, ensured fair administration, and created a strong military system.
